Highly asymmetric bipolar resistive switching in solution-processed Pt/TiO2/W devices for cross-point application

Biju, Kuyyadi P.; Liu, Xinjun; Shin, Jungho; Kim, Insung; Jung, Seungjae; Siddik, Manzar; Lee, Joonmyoung; Ignatiev, Alex; Hwang, Hyunsang

Description

Resistive switching characteristics of Pt/TiO2/W devices are investigated. TiO2 thin films are grown by a sol-gel spin-coating technique. The crystal structure and chemical bonding states of the TiO2 films are investigated by X-ray diffraction and X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y. The device exhibits reversible and reproducible bistable resistive switching with a rectifying effect.
